Title:  Filtrations and test-configurations

Abstract:   Test-configurations are certain degenerations of projective
manifolds, used in the definition of K-stability, which in
turn is related to the existence of special metrics. I will explain
how filtrations of the homogeneous coordinate ring of a projective
manifold can be thought of as sequences of test-configurations, and
that they encode the limiting behavior of these sequences. Such
filtrations arise naturally when studying the Calabi flow, or when
trying to minimize the Calabi functional. I will also discuss how
filtrations can be used to give a strengthening of the notion of
K-stability, and why this is desirable.
